A Study of BL-B01D1 in Patients With Multiple Solid Tumors, Including Locally Advanced or Metastatic Urinary System Tumors
Phase IIa/IIb Clinical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ability,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y of BL-B01D1 for Injection in Patients With Multiple Solid Tumors, Including Locally Advanced or Metastatic Urinary System Tumors

Summary
Phase IIa/IIb clinical study to evaluate the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ics and efficacy of BL-B01D1 for injection in patients with multiple solid tumors such as locally advanced or metastatic urinary system tumors.
Detailed description
Phase IIa: To explore the safety and initial efficacy of BL-B01D1 in a variety of solid tumors such as locally advanced or metastatic urinary system tumors, and further determine RP2D. The preliminary efficacy, pharmacokinetic characteristics and immunogenicity of BL-B01D1 were evaluated. Phase IIb: To explore the efficacy of BL-B01D1 as a single agent RP2D obtained in a Phase IIa clinical study. To evaluate the safety and tolerability, pharmacokinetic characteristics and immunogenicity of BL-B01D1.
